Designed and operated like a home, Ryan House is built from the ground up to provide quality pediatric palliative care as well as appropriate therapies and activities in a supportive home-like setting.
Great Room

Using the great-room concept, the family room has many inviting areas for individuals, families or small groups. This large, attractive room includes a library, reading corners, a captivating light wall, video games, TV and cozy furniture groupings. It is bathed in light with open views and access to the outdoor play area and patio.
Art/Activity Room
Designed for different age groups with multiple activities available, it is quite probable that the door may often be closed due to the level of activity! However, when the door opens one is likely to see a painting in progress, a puzzle partially completed, a trunk overflowing with “dress-up” items, a train set, foosball table and lots of other interesting opportunities for fun and learning for the children and their siblings. It’s a favorite of the parents as well!
Sensory Room
This room is not one that would be found in a typical home; it’s a captivating and special room designed to help children express themselves – to help them respond. It is small in size but large in its capacity to reach children in a variety of ways. Because it is sound proof, one can bang on drums or perhaps just let off steam. It is truly a room to experience, awash with with lights, sounds, colors and different textures that stimulate a child’s senses.
Hydrotherapy Room
Both the children and their families enjoy using this room. Hydrotherapy helps people relax, improves sleep, provides pain relief and improves circulation. This “spa” may be a wonderful way for a family to enjoy each other’s company.
Music Room
Filled with different instruments and a variety of audio/visual equipment, this room is used for music therapy and just plain fun for the entire family.
Landscaped Patios and Playground Area
Children and their families enjoy the landscaped outdoor areas whether they are inside looking out, or outside in the yard relaxing and playing. A colorful and inviting accessible playground stands at the center of the patio area.
Children’s Bedrooms
Ryan House has eight bedrooms designed to meet the needs of children who stay there, yet have the appeal of a child’s room at home. Parents enjoy a comfortable over-stuffed chair or a rocking chair for their use as well as a place to sleep if they wish. Each bedroom has direct access to the landscaped outdoor area.
Family Bedrooms
Appreciating that families know their children best, and how hard it can be to let someone else take over for a while, Ryan House staff must be knowledgeable about each child and the specific care provided by the parents. To accommodate this need, there are three family suites at Ryan House where families will are encouraged to stay during the first visit and will always be welcome. Family suites will ensure that care and treatment is always family-centered.
Specially Designed Bathing Room
Most of the children staying at Ryan House need assistance bathing. Ryan House has a welcoming room with the necessary lift, bathing bed and shower to ensure good hygiene, safety and privacy.
Reflection Room and Memorial Garden
These quiet, non-denominational areas are a comforting place for families, friends, caregivers and all others to spend time alone or with others coping with similar challenges. It stands as a peaceful area to reflect, share, mediate, pray, plan or perhaps just a place “to be” at a particular time.
Board Room
The board room within the administrative area is used by different groups and for many purposes including family support groups, education/training, Board meetings, special event planning, meeting room for other complementary non-profits and for Ryan House volunteers.
